Домашня » як » Легко створюйте віртуальні машини KVM на Linux з коробками GNOME

    Легко створюйте віртуальні машини KVM на Linux з коробками GNOME

    Вам не потрібні засоби віртуалізації сторонніх виробників, такі як VirtualBox і VMware на Linux. KVM (віртуальна машина на основі ядра) - це технологія відкритої віртуалізації, вбудована в ядро ​​Linux. Ящики GNOME забезпечують досить простий інтерфейс, що полегшує використання.

    Раніше ми рекомендували використовувати інструмент Virt-Manager для створення віртуальних машин KVM. Boxes - більш зручний інструмент, призначений для середніх користувачів настільних ПК замість системних адміністраторів ... Незважаючи на назву, ви можете запустити його на будь-якому робочому середовищі.

    Це вимагає Intel VT-x або AMD-V

    Технічно це додаток використовує QEMU, що робить підтримку віртуальних машин на основі KVM на основі апаратно-прискореної віртуалізації..

    KVM вимагає наявності або розширень апаратної віртуалізації Intel VT-x або AMD-V. На комп'ютерах з процесорами Intel, можливо, доведеться звернутися до екрана налаштувань BIOS або UEFI, щоб активувати розширення апаратної віртуалізації Intel VT-x. Якщо у вас немає функцій апаратної віртуалізації, KVM не працюватиме - для цього потрібно використовувати VirtualBox або VMware. Ящики повідомлятимуть, якщо у вашій системі немає доступних розширень KVM, коли ви намагаєтеся створити віртуальну машину.

    Встановіть коробки GNOME

    Ящики GNOME повинні бути доступні майже в кожному репозиторії програмного забезпечення Linux, оскільки воно є частиною робочого середовища GNOME. Зверніться до менеджера пакунків вашого дистрибутива Linux або інсталятора програмного забезпечення та знайдіть Boxes, щоб встановити його.

    Ящики повинні втягувати все, що потрібно, коли ви встановлюєте його, так що не повинно бути ніякої додаткової конфігурації.

    Коробки не повністю замінюють Virt-Manager, який все ще пропонує більш розширені можливості. Наприклад, він має більше можливостей для налаштування параметрів віртуальної машини, а також підтримки створення та відновлення знімків віртуальних машин. Якщо вам потрібні більш розширені функції, наприклад, встановіть Virt-Manager.

    Створення та завантаження віртуальних машин

    Щоб розпочати роботу, запустіть програму Boxes з меню або запустіть команду gnome-boxes. У вікні Boxes спочатку це трохи безплідно - це тому, що у головному вікні буде розміщено список віртуальних машин, які ви створюєте. Натисніть кнопку "Створити", щоб налаштувати нову віртуальну машину.

    У вікнах GNOME з'явиться вступ, в якому пояснюється, що він може створювати локальні віртуальні машини, які працюють на комп'ютерах або віртуальних машинах на віддаленому сервері.

    Натисніть майстер, надавши файл ISO для встановлення віртуальної машини. Ви можете завантажити ISO ISO для віртуалізації або навіть отримати ISO-файли Windows від Microsoft - якщо ви маєте законний ключ продукту Windows для використання, звичайно,.

    Як і інші інструменти віртуалізації, вікна автоматично виявлятимуть операційну систему у файлі ISO, який ви надаєте, і надаєте рекомендовані параметри за замовчуванням. Ви повинні просто натиснути "Продовжити" і пройти майстер, автоматично прийняти параметри за промовчанням та отримати віртуальну машину для вашої системи.

    Кнопка "Налаштувати" на екрані "Перегляд" дозволяє налаштувати кілька простих налаштувань, наприклад, скільки пам'яті потрібно виділити віртуальній машині. Більш просунута конфігурація вимагатиме Virt-Manager замість Boxes.

    Тепер можна просто натиснути кнопку "Створити", щоб створити віртуальну машину і завантажити її вперше за допомогою інсталяційного носія. Встановіть операційну систему нормально у віртуальну машину. Коли ви знову відкриєте вікна, ви побачите список встановлених віртуальних машин, що дозволяють швидко їх запускати.


    Коробки не для всіх. Більш просунуті функції, які все ще використовують QEMU-KVM, можна знайти у VIrt-Manager. Інші функції можуть вимагати використання VirtualBox або VMware, які є більш полірованими та зрілими програмами з багатьма простими у використанні функціями, включаючи пакунки драйверів апаратних засобів, таких як VirtualBox Guest Vits та VMware Tools, які допомагають прискорювати графіку віртуальних машин і надають такі можливості, як доступ до USB-пристрої підключені до вашого фізичного комп'ютера з віртуальної машини.

    Але, якщо ви шукаєте основні функції віртуалізації у простому додатку - такому, який використовує власні функції KVM Linux та інших відкритих програм - дайте Boxes (або його більшого брата, Virt-Manager) спробу. Вона повинна стати більш потужною, гнучкою і швидкою, оскільки основне програмне забезпечення віртуалізації з відкритим кодом продовжує покращуватися.